The main difference between \(K\) and \(Q\) is that \(K\) describes a reaction that is at equilibrium, whereas \(Q\) describes a reaction that is not at equilibrium. In a reaction at equilibrium, the equilibrium concentrations of all reactants and products can be measured. If K >> 1, the reaction is product-favored ; product predominates at equilibrium. The \(Q\) equation is written as the concentrations of the products divided by the concentrations of the reactants, but only including components in the gaseous or aqueous states and omitting pure liquid or solid states.
